Ingredients:
- 10 chicken drumsticks.
- 4 stalks of celery
- 8 organic carrots
- 1 green onion
- 1 Vidalia Onion
- 1 bag of red potatoes
- 2 bell peppers [1 red and 1 green for color]
- 1 small bag of brown rice
- 2 boxes of chicken broth
Spices:
- Rosemary
- Chili Powder
- Curry
- Oregano
- Basil
- Season Salt
- Pepper
- Italian Seasoning
- Salt
- Garlic Powder
- Onion Powder
Tools:
- 1 Large pot
- 1 skillet
- 1 knife
- 1 wooden spoon
- 1 pair of tongs
- 1 Large Bowl
Make sure you prep everything before you start cooking meaning: have your vegetables chopped and sliced before doing anything. The onions, carrots, bell peppers, and celery can all be roughly chopped. Not too chunky but not too thin.
- Heat up the skillet as well as the pot. A small half-inch slice of butter in each. Remember keep the heat low!
- Season the chicken drumsticks in the bowl with all the spices. Make sure to use your hands and toss the chicken [like you would a salad] to ensure the seasoning covers as much as possible. Use small handfuls of each seasoning. DON'T OVER DO IT!
- Place the drumsticks in the skill [you wont be able to fit all of them in at once]. Turn the heat up a little bit
- As the chicken cooks, throw the vegetables in the big pot. Let them soften before adding the chicken broth. To the broth add a few shakes of season salt, pepper, and curry.
- As the chicken browns put it inside the pot. Once all the drumsticks are done let them simmer in the pot.
- Add the rice last inside the pot. Now leave the pot alone, clean up your mess, and let everything come together.
- Check the pot approximately 1 hour to 1 hour and 45 minutes later.
